How to fill out a licence to publish in:

01
Obtain the necessary form: Begin by obtaining the appropriate licence to publish form from the relevant authority or organization. This form is usually available online on their website or can be requested by mail or in person.
02
Read the instructions: Before starting to fill out the form, carefully read through the instructions provided. Understanding the requirements and guidelines is crucial to ensure that the application is completed correctly.
03
Personal information: The first section of the form will typically require you to provide your personal information, such as your name, contact details, and any relevant affiliations or organizations you may be associated with. Fill in this section accurately and legibly.
04
Title or description of the work: Specify the title or description of the work that you intend to publish. This may include the name of your book, article, research paper, or any other form of content you wish to distribute.
05
Copyright information: Provide details about the copyright ownership of the work. This may include information about any co-authors or contributors and their respective rights to the content.
06
Licensing terms: The form may ask you to specify the licensing terms under which you are granting permission to publish. These terms can vary depending on your preferences and the specific rights you want to grant to others.
07
Publication details: Include information about the intended publication, such as the publisher's name, location, and anticipated publication date. If the publication is online or digital, provide the necessary website or platform details.
08
Sign and submit: Finally, carefully review the completed form, ensuring all sections are filled in correctly. Sign and date the form in the designated areas. Make a copy for your records and submit the original form as instructed, whether by mail, email, or online submission.

Who needs a licence to publish in?

01
Authors and writers: Authors who wish to publish their written works, including books, articles, or blog posts, often require a licence to publish. This ensures that their work is protected and provides legal permission for others to distribute or use it.
02
Researchers and academics: Scholarly authors and researchers who produce academic papers, theses, or dissertations may need a licence to publish to safeguard their intellectual property and control the dissemination of their research.
03
Content creators: Individuals who create artistic or creative content, such as photographers, musicians, or filmmakers, might require a licence to publish to protect their work and regulate its usage by others.
04
Publishing companies: Publishing companies and organizations that intend to distribute books, magazines, or any other form of content produced by various authors or creators usually need a licence to publish to operate legally and to ensure they have the necessary permissions for distribution.
05
Website owners and bloggers: In the digital age, website owners, bloggers, and online content creators must often obtain a licence to publish to ensure compliance with copyright laws and obtain legal permission for hosting or reproducing certain types of content.
Remember, the specific requirements for a licence to publish may vary depending on the country, type of content, and the intended audience. It is essential to consult the relevant authorities or seek legal advice to ensure compliance with applicable laws and regulations.
